This training is designed to orient and assist the professionals entering the role of Social Worker, Resource Coordinator, Supervisor or District Director within the first 6 months of hire. This seminar provides an overview of the knowledge, values and skills needed in the following areas:

  • Understand a range of emotional and behavioral outcomes of sexual abuse.
  • Explore dynamics and characteristics of incestuous families.
  • Identify characteristics and behavioral changes of children and youth who have been sexually abused.
  • Learn healthy and helpful ways to work with children and youth who have a history of being sexual abuse victims.
